SHARE REPORTS.
HONGKONG, 8th Aug.-The general stagna- tion in our market contiuues, and the business transacted during the interval has again been very limited in extent,
BANKS.-Hongkong and Shanghais are re- ported sold at $610, but more shares can be obtained. London rate is unchanged at £63.
MARINE INSURANCES.-Unions continue in request at $390, and Cautous at $160. China Traders are quoted at 857 sellers, and North Chinas at Tls. 187 sellers
FIRE INSURANCES.- hinas maintain their position, with buyers at $81. Hongkongs can still be procured at $337.
SHIPPING.-Hongkong. Canton and Macaos have been disposed of at $37 ex the interim dividend of $15 per share paid on the 6th inst., and further shares are on offer. Indo-Chinas are weak at $88 with sellers. China Mauilas have declined to $ 2 ellers. Shell Transports have been done at the reduced rate of £1. 128, 6d. REFINERIES.-China Sugars have been in strong demand at low rates during the week. and a very fair parcel has changed hands as we close at $105, with further enquiry. Luzons are unchanged at $20 sellers.
MINING. Jelehus have been done at 70 cents. In other stocks we have heard of no business.
DOCKS, WHARVES AND GODOWNS.-Hong. kong and Whampoa Docks, under the influence of a disappointing dividend for the past halť year, have suffered a severe decline and are now quoted at $198 with small buyers. Hong- kong and Kowloon Wharves have slightly improved and have been sold at 889. New Amoy Docks are still in request at $36.
LANDS, HOTELS AND BUILDINGS.-Hong- kong Lands have sold at $169 and $168. and are still on offer at the lower figure. There are no changes to report in other stocks under this head.
COTTON MILLS.-Ewos can be placed at Tis. 41, and Laou Kung Mows at Tls. 42. Hongkong Cottons are quiet with sellers at $174.

Shanghai 6th August (from Messrs. J. P. Bisset & Co.'s Report). During the week under review two Bank holidays intervened and business was restricted. FIRE INSURANCE.-There in no local business to report. SHIPPING.-Indo-China Steam Navigation Co, shares changed hands for cash at 66 67, declined to 64 and have recovered to 65. - For October shares were placed at 68, 71 and 67. SUGARS. - China Sugar Refining shares declined to $99, but have recovered to $101. MINING.-- sold at TIs. 900,8.00 cash and 9.00 for August, Chinese Engineering and Mining shares were DOCKS, WHARVES and GoDOWNS.-Shares in 8. C. Farnham, Boyd and Co. were sold at Tls. 1974, 200 and 205 cash, closing at 200. Shanghai and · Hongkow Wharf Co. shares were placed at Tls. 292). LANDS.-Shanghai Land Investment shares were sold at Tis. 115 cum new issue, and are offering. Weihaiwei shares are offering. IN- DUSTRIAL. Shanghai Pulp and Paper shares were sold at Tls. 110.
